General Description
The LM2686 CMOS charge-pump voltage converter operates as an input voltage doubler and a +5V
regulator for an input voltage in the range of +2.85V to +6.5V. Three low cost capacitors are used in this circuit to provide up to 50mA of output current at +5.0V ( ± 5%). The LM2686 operates at a 130 kHz switching frequency to reduce output resistance and voltage ripple. With an operating current of only 450µA (operating efficiency greater than 80% with most loads) and 6.0µA typical shutdown current, the LM2686 is ideal for use in battery powered systems. The device is in a small 14-pin TSSOP package.
